How to Set Up Alexa Smart Home Devices

Step-by-Step Setup Guide

Device Installation

  1. Physical Setup: Screw Hue bulbs, plug Kasa, mount Ring, or wire Ecobee.
  2. Power On: Ensure devices are live.
  3. Wi-Fi: Connect to 2.4GHz band for stability (not 5GHz).
  • Setup Alexa smart home devices starts with proper placement .

Alexa Integration

  1. App: Open Alexa app, tap “Devices” > “Add Device.”
  2. Scan/Link: Detect Blink, Kasa, or link via Ring, Hue apps.
  3. Groups: Create “Kitchen” or “Front Door” for multi-device control.
  4. Routines: Set “Away” (lights on, lock secured) or “Evening” (dim Govee).
  • Integrate Alexa devices 2025 for automation bliss (~10 min).

Troubleshooting

  • Wi-Fi Drops: Reboot router, move devices closer.
  • Unresponsive: Reset (e.g., Hue on/off 5x), check Zigbee range (~30 ft).
  • Firmware: Update via brand apps. Fix Alexa smart home problems with patience.

Frequently Asked Questions About Alexa Smart Home Devices

Q1: Do I need an Echo for Alexa smart devices?

No, Alexa app suffices, but Echo adds voice control and Zigbee hubs.

Q2: Which Echo is best for smart home control?

Echo 5th Gen or Studio for Zigbee/Matter; Show for visual feeds.

Q3: Are Alexa devices compatible with non-Amazon brands?

Yes, Hue, Kasa, Ecobee work via Wi-Fi, Zigbee, or Matter.

Q4: Do Alexa smart devices need constant Wi-Fi?

Yes for most; Hue with Bridge or Zigbee Echos work offline for basics.
